C. BUSINESS BACKGROUND
As visual content becomes increasingly essential in both personal and commercial life, the demand for professional photography continues to grow. In Ciamis, however, quality studios are still limited. Pradik Studio aims to fill this gap by offering professional visuals, creative concepts, and customer-oriented services.

I. FINANCIAL PLAN
Initial Investment:
-
Camera & lenses: IDR 25,000,000
-
Lighting & backdrops: IDR 10,000,000
-
Editing computer: IDR 15,000,000
-
Studio rent (initial): IDR 5,000,000/month
-
Renovation & interior: IDR 8,000,000
-
Working capital: IDR 7,000,000
Total: IDR 70,000,000
Estimated Monthly Revenue:
-
Studio sessions (30 x IDR 500,000): IDR 15,000,000
-
Event documentation: IDR 5,000,000–10,000,000
Total: ±IDR 20,000,000–25,000,000
Estimated Monthly Operational Costs:
-
Staff salary: IDR 3,000,000
-
Rent: IDR 5,000,000
-
Electricity & internet: IDR 1,000,000
-
Promotion and miscellaneous: IDR 2,000,000
Total: ±IDR 11,000,000
Estimated Net Profit: ±IDR 9,000,000/month

Active Sentences:
Active sentences emphasize the doer of the action.
- The photographer takes photos of the model with a vintage camera. (Focus on the photographer performing the action of taking photos)
- The model wears a beautiful red dress. (Focus on the model performing the action of wearing the dress)
- The creative team designs the photoshoot concept in detail. (Focus on the creative team performing the action of designing)
- The magazine editor selects the best photos for publication. (Focus on the editor performing the action of selecting)
- The makeup artist applies makeup to the model professionally. (Focus on the makeup artist performing the action of applying makeup)
- The photographer's assistant carries the photography equipment. (Focus on the assistant performing the action of carrying)
- The fashion designer creates the latest clothing collection. (Focus on the designer performing the action of creating)
- The stylist carefully arranges the model's hair. (Focus on the stylist performing the action of arranging)
- The fashion company promotes their products through the photos. (Focus on the company performing the action of promoting)
- Photography enthusiasts admire the photographer's work. (Focus on the enthusiasts performing the action of admiring)
Passive Sentences:
Passive sentences emphasize the object that receives the action.
- Photos of the model are taken by the photographer with a vintage camera. (Focus on the photos being taken)
- A beautiful red dress is worn by the model. (Focus on the dress being worn)
- The photoshoot concept is designed in detail by the creative team. (Focus on the concept being designed)
- The best photos are selected for publication by the magazine editor. (Focus on the photos being selected)
- Makeup is applied to the model professionally by the makeup artist. (Focus on the makeup being applied)
- The photography equipment is carried by the photographer's assistant. (Focus on the equipment being carried)
- The latest clothing collection is created by the fashion designer. (Focus on the collection being created)
- The model's hair is carefully arranged by the stylist. (Focus on the hair being arranged)
- Their products are promoted through the photos by the fashion company. (Focus on the products being promoted)
- The photographer's work is admired by photography enthusiasts. (Focus on the work being admired)
